Assessing Team Accreditations and Experience



How can you ensure your dog remains in great hands at daycare? Beginning by analyzing the personnel's qualifications and experience.

Look for trainers and caretakers with accreditations in pet treatment, habits training, or animal emergency treatment. These credentials show they're well-informed and capable of handling different circumstances.

Ask about their experience working with pets, especially the breed and character of your own hairy pal. Observe their interactions with pet dogs: do they display perseverance and understanding?

A passionate group will certainly prioritize your pet's wellness and joy. Don't think twice to ask about ongoing training or specialist development possibilities for the team.

This dedication to development can show a top quality daycare that values its employees and, eventually, the canines in their treatment.

Reviewing Center Tidiness and Security



Once you have actually examined the team's qualifications, it's time to examine the facility itself.

Beginning by looking for sanitation; a properly maintained atmosphere indicates a commitment to your canine's health. Try to find tidy floorings, fresh air, and a lack of unpleasant odors.

Take notice of the exterior locations as well-- are they safeguard and without debris?

Safety is essential, so inspect the fencing and entrances to guarantee they're safe. Check for any kind of possible risks, like exposed wires or sharp objects.

You should likewise observe just how the center deals with emergency situations-- are there first aid packages readily offered?



Ultimately, ask about their hygiene techniques, including exactly how typically they clean up the backyard. A clean and secure center will certainly give you satisfaction for your hairy good friend.

Checking for Health and Inoculation Demands



What can be more crucial than your pet dog's wellness when choosing a childcare? Before registering your furry good friend, see to it the facility requires updated inoculations. Common vaccinations include rabies, Bordetella, and distemper.

Request a copy of their health and wellness policy and look for any type of added requirements, like flea and tick prevention.

It's vital to make sure that the day care screens dogs for health problems, as this assists protect against the spread of illness. Inquire about their procedure for managing ill dogs and just how they manage any prospective outbreaks.

A responsible daycare ought to focus on the health and safety of all animals. By verifying these health and wellness demands, you'll assist develop a risk-free environment for your canine and other fuzzy companions.

Observing Daily Activities and Enrichment Options



While you want to guarantee your pet dog is healthy, observing the daily activities and enrichment options at a daycare is similarly essential.

Watch exactly how staff involves with the pet dogs; do they urge play, socialization, and exploration? Search for organized activities like dexterity training courses or puzzle playthings that boost your canine emotionally and literally.

A good day care ought to supply a range of enrichment options, helping to avoid monotony and stress and anxiety. Notice if there's a balance between free play and led tasks, as both are essential for your canine's health.

Focus on the atmosphere, as well-- exist secure rooms for dogs to unwind?

Considering Location, Hours, and Rates



Picking the ideal pet dog day care entails more than simply analyzing tasks; you additionally require to think about location, hours, and rates.

Begin by inspecting just how close the daycare is to your home or work environment-- benefit can make drop-offs and pick-ups trouble-free. Next, look at the hours of operation. Ensure they align with your routine, particularly if you work long hours or have irregular changes.

Ultimately, assess the rates framework. Some day cares bill daily, while others offer packages or discount rates for longer dedications. Guarantee you comprehend what's consisted of in the cost, like meals or additional activities.

Balancing these variables will certainly help you find a day care that fits both your requirements and your hairy friend's way of living.
